Question Quick Spark Plug Question?

I think I might have mixed up my ignition wires when putting in new plugs.

So, do both leading and trailing 1 go in the front rotor? On the coils it says L1, T1. I dont want to get it wrong.

I'm pretty sure that T1 goes on top on the front rotor, L1 goes on bottom of the ront rotor, T2 goes on the top of the rear rotor, and L2 goes on the rear bottom rotor.


T1 T2

L1 L2
